Who won the 1 billion dollar lottery?

The winners — John and Lisa Robinson in Tennessee, Maureen Smith and David Kaltschmidt in Florida and Marvin and Mae Acosta in California — split the full prize, giving them the option of roughly $533 million before taxes as an annuity or $327.8 million as the lump-sum payment.

Can a tourist win the lottery in USA?

You can buy US lottery tickets, win the Powerball and the Mega Millions lotteries, and collect your jackpot no matter what your US residence status is. And of course, since non-US residents are eligible to buy the tickets, they are also eligible to claim the prize money should they win.

How much was the first lottery jackpot?

The first draw took place on 19 November 1994 with a television programme presented by Noel Edmonds. The first numbers drawn were 30, 3, 5, 44, 14 and 22, the bonus was 10, and seven jackpot winners shared a prize of £5,874,778.

What happened to people who won lottery?

An often-cited — but incorrect — anecdote about lottery winners falsely attributed to the National Endowment for Financial Education claims that about 70% of people who suddenly receive a windfall of cash will lose it within a few years.
